Cardiff City defender Matt Connolly joins Watford in shock loan move

Thurs March 2015

By Chris Wathan

Defender Connolly is the latest Cardiff player to leave the club on loan despite figuring in recent first-team matches


Cardiff defender Matt ConnollyCardiff defender Matt Connolly

Matthew Connolly has made a shock loan move to Watford – just days after starting for the Bluebirds in Championship action.

Connolly, part of the promotion-winning side under Malky Mackay, had been a regular under Russell Slade and featured for Cardiff in Tuesday night’s draw with Bournemouth.

Yet he has been allowed to leave South Wales to join Championship rivals Watford on loan until the end of the season.

Primarily a centre-back, Connolly has operated at right-back and made 26 appearances this year having originally signed for the club from QPR in a £500,000 deal in 2012.

The 27-year-old made it a hat-trick of Premier League promotions at Cardiff City Stadium having also gone up with QPR and Reading.


The move to the promotion-chasers will shock Cardiff fans given his first-team status, Slade having overseen the exit of a number of stars since his appointment in October as part of what has been described as a need to slash the club’s wage budget.

Connolly, who had been expected to keep his place in the side for Saturday’s visit of Birmingham, has two years remaining on his Bluebirds deal.

A Cardiff City statement said: "We have accepted a loan offer for Matthew Connolly from Watford FC.

"Matthew will link up with the Hornets immediately, subject to international clearance. The emergency loan spell will run until June 1st 2015 inclusive.

"We wish Matthew the very best of luck during his time at Vicarage Road."
